Jo Allyn Lowe Park (Hwy.75 south and west on Price Road) is dedicated to Jo Allyn Lowe, the beloved founder of Bartlesville Boys Club. This 31 acre public park is home to an arboretum with 341 labeled trees representing 140 species and cultivars, plus 4 acres of native grass. Walkers and joggers enjoy the many paths that surround the lake and wind thru adjacent tallgrass prairie, the only tallgrass prairie in OK located inside city limits. Enjoy the many different species of ducks and geese that populate the park and lake. A handicap accessible fishing pier is located at the south end of the lake.
To fnd Letterbox "Bug Me" #2, park in the west parking lot and enjoy walking the paths east of the pond. Tunnel vision is required to find this letterbox. After passing the 2nd electrical pole on your left, look to the west for a group of three tree trunks, one of which is home to the letterbox.
A stamp pad is NOT available.
